We are looking for a volunteer to be present at Byker Job Centre and offer information on recovery resources in the Newcastle area to people identified by the job centre staff who present with support needs. The role will involve attending Byker Job Centre at an agreed time. You will need to have up to date information regarding recovery resources available to people who request this information. For example- information on meetings, groups and relevant services. You will be expected to sit in on one to ones or to have one to one conversations regarding recovery support and to offer people hope and inspiration. The role requires an individual to have completed all Changing Lives required training and volunteer induction and to complete an enhanced DBS application. Applicants need to have good communication skills and have a good knowledge of recovery resources in the Newcastle area. You will be part of a team and will get regular support from a volunteer co-ordinator.
